Contract Personnel are delighted to be recruiting on behalf of an independent technology company based in Norwich, specialising in printing solutions, for a Trainee Photocopier Engineer.
This is an exciting role for someone looking to start their career in a tech related field, where they can learn on the job & gain useful experience.
Key responsibilities:
To attend technical calls of multi-functional devices, support customers with setup of copier features like, printing, scanning, booklets etc...
To attend customer sites to install upgraded or refurbished multi-functional devices
Provide remote IT support for multi-functional devices when required
Preparation and set up of new multi-functional devices, including delivery
Key requirements:
Experience in computer networking would be an advantage but not essential
Although part of a team, can work independently
Able to demonstrate fault finding skills
Excellent customer service skills and able to easily build rapport
Self-motivated and well organised
Fast and keen self-learner
Full training will be provided, so soft skills are most important
This position is Monday to Friday, 08:45am - 5pm, and will see the successful applicant working both on and off site.
Due to the nature of the role, a driving licence in required
